WHAT DOES PHONOSCOPE MEAN IN ENGLISH?

Phonoscope Communications

Phonoscope Communications is a broadband and cable television provider with corporate headquarters in Houston, Texas. The company's infrastructure spans seven counties and reaches distant locations such as Baytown, Freeport, Magnolia, Richmond-Rosenberg, Splendora, Texas City and Willis, Texas.

Definition of phonoscope in the English dictionary

The definition of phonoscope in the dictionary is a device that renders visible the vibrations of sound waves.

Alice Guy Blaché: Lost Visionary of the Cinema
In July of 1891, however, Demeny gave a demonstration of his phonoscope at the Musee Grevin.18 The phonoscope was a projector designed to reproduce the living manner of a subject as s/he pronounced short phrases. (One film shows ...
Alison McMahan, 2002
